senior Software Engineer ic Remote · Posted Feb 19, 2026

About this role

GitHub is hiring a senior-level Software Engineer as a remote position. The posting calls out experience with Python, Ruby, Bash, Git.

Role
Software Engineer
Function
software engineering
Level
senior
Track
Individual contributor
Location
United States
Work mode
Remote
Department
Engineering
Posted
Feb 19, 2026
AI Summary
Design and build physical infrastructure systems, frameworks, and tools for GitHub's data centers. Lead capacity planning, implement security measures, establish monitoring systems, and collaborate with cross-functional teams to optimize infrastructure performance and scalability.

More roles at GitHub

Senior Software Engineer, Elasticsearch
United Kingdom · senior
Python Rust Ruby
New Media Director
United States · director
Git A/B Testing SaaS
Staff Security Researcher
Germany · senior
Git Security Performance Optimization
Staff Software Engineer, Traffic Team
United Kingdom · staff
Python JavaScript Java
SMB Senior Account Executive
Japan · senior
Git
All GitHub jobs →

Job description

from GitHub careers
About GitHub

GitHub is the world’s leading platform for agentic software development — powered by Copilot to build, scale, and deliver secure software. Over 180 million developers, including more than 90% of the Fortune 100 companies, use GitHub to collaborate, and more than 77,000 organisations have adopted GitHub Copilot.

Locations

In this role you can work from Remote, United States

Overview

GitHub is growing its Engineering team and we're seeking experienced professionals to elevate our Physical Infrastructure efforts. As a Senior Software Engineer, you will design, build, and enhance physical infrastructure frameworks and tools, ensuring scalable and efficient data centers. The ideal candidate will be a key contributor to enhancing GitHub’s physical infrastructure, ensuring scalability and efficiency while gaining valuable experience in data center architecture, hardware innovation, and cross-functional collaboration to support developers globally.

As an Infrastructure Engineer, you will report into GitHub's larger Platform organization. Platform is a distributed group that owns internal services, tools, and infrastructure used to build, deploy, and operate the services that make up GitHub. Built in our own data centers with a variety of open source software, our services are used by dozens of engineering teams across the company. We strive to act as a productivity multiplier by offering our customers the tools they need to deliver their services, allowing them to focus more on product.

This is an excerpt. Read the full job description on GitHub careers →
All software engineering jobs software engineering salaries software engineering career path
All GitHub Jobs Browse software engineering roles senior positions